Asphalt sealcoating acts as a protective layer, shielding pavement from harmful elements such as UV rays, oil spillage, and water damage. This barrier ensures that roads remain smooth and functional for longer periods, reducing the need for frequent repairs. But how exactly does innovation in this area translate to better roads?
To begin with, one of the key aspects of innovation in asphalt sealcoating is the introduction of advanced materials. Modern sealants incorporate polymers and other additives that significantly boost the performance of traditional asphalt. These materials are designed to improve flexibility, allowing pavements to withstand harsh weather conditions without cracking. As a result, roads are able to maintain their structural integrity for years, minimizing the long-term maintenance costs.

The application technology has also seen significant improvements. High-tech equipment and precision techniques ensure that the sealcoat is applied evenly and consistently. These advancements reduce the likelihood of human error and enhance the overall efficiency of the process. Modern machinery can quickly cover large areas, reducing the time roads need to be closed for maintenance and minimizing disruption to traffic.
Furthermore, data-driven approaches have become a cornerstone of innovative asphalt sealcoating. Utilizing data analytics, companies can now predict wear patterns and identify high-risk areas on roads before significant damage occurs. This proactive approach allows for targeted maintenance, ensuring that resources are utilized efficiently and effectively.
